Photoshop for Fine Art Photographers, Mastering Masking

Mastering Masking continues Dan’s Photoshop for Fine Art Photographers series by exploring one of creative photography’s most treasured tools: masking. Often misunderstood or poorly presented, you’ll leave this class with a newly discovered comfort level with one of Photoshop’s most important fine-art controls. (Besides, where else can you learn from a Photographer who for three decades has adored masking and the control it brings to the fine art image.)

  • Discover which areas of an image benefit from the types of changes that masking makes easy.
  • From masking basics to intermediate masking tasks, you’ll grasp one of Photoshop’s most valued techniques to control specific areas of your images.
  • Learn how Dan’s “Make a selection; then do something to it” system opens your eyes to the ease and power of masking. 
  • Discover new selection techniques to use when masks aren’t the best choice.
  • Dan demystifies Quick Mask Mode, giving you quick and easy control of color, contrast, sharpness and intrigue in any part of your photo. You’ll ask yourself how you ever lived without Quick Mask!
  • Understand Luminosity Masks taught by a working artist who never uses geek-speak.
  • Master Blending Modes once and for all (hint: you don’t need to know them all).

You’ll complete this online session with an exciting new familiarity with masking methods that put you in control of your image editing steps. Dan thrives on your questions during this small class so don’t hesitate to ask about anything! 

Participants are encouraged to work on Dan’s demo images using their own version of Photoshop. A video of the entire session will be provided afterwards so you can review any part of the session that wasn’t perfectly clear.
